    SDXL Turbo Revolutionizes Real-Time Text-to-Image Generation****

    SDXL Turbo is a cutting-edge text-to-image generation technology that utilizes Adversarial Diffusion Distillation (ADD), a novel technique enabling real-time image synthesis. By combining adversarial training and score distillation, it produces high-quality, 512×512 pixel images in as few as 1-4 steps.

    Model Architecture and Approach

    SDXL Turbo: Real-time Prompting - iPic.ai - Create Beautiful Ai Art or Ai Images For Free

    Introducing SDXL Turbo: Real-Time Text-to-Image Generation

    SDXL Turbo employs Adversarial Diffusion Distillation (ADD), a groundbreaking technique that enables single-step image synthesis with high sampling fidelity. This novel distillation technique combines adversarial training and score distillation, eliminating artifacts and blurriness commonly associated with other models.

    Architectural Consistency and Performance

    SDXL Turbo utilizes the same architecture as SDXL, ensuring seamless integration and minimal computational requirements. The model generates 512×512 images and operates best with 1 to 4 steps, using a ‘timestep_spacing=’trailing” configuration. This consistency contributes to the model’s broad compatibility with existing systems, leveraging SDXL’s established framework for efficient inference.

    To effectively use SDXL Turbo, it is crucial to update Comfy UI to include the new nodes, such as the SD Turbo Scheduler and Case Sampler, which are essential for the SDXL Turbo workflow. The model also performs optimally by disabling guidance scale by setting ‘guidance_scale=0.0’. This consistency guarantees high performance and makes SDXL Turbo an ideal choice for real-time text-to-image generation applications.

    Performance Evaluation Results

    SDXL Turbo Performance Highlights

    SDXL Turbo outperforms other models in real-time text-to-image generation by producing high-quality images in 1 to 4 steps. It surpasses 4-step LCM-XL configurations with a single step and 50-step SDXL configurations with just four steps.

    Key Performance Metrics

    • Generation Speed: SDXL Turbo generates a 512×512 image in 207ms on an A100, with only 67ms attributed to a single UNet forward evaluation.
    • Image Quality: User feedback from blind tests indicates that SDXL Turbo is preferred for its image quality and prompt following over other models like LCM-XL and StyleGAN-T++.
    • Innovation: The model’s Adversarial Diffusion Distillation (ADD) training method ensures high image fidelity even in low-step regimes.
    • Real-Time Applications: SDXL Turbo’s real-time image generation capabilities are showcased on Clipdrop, Stability AI’s image editing platform, making it suitable for dynamic environments.

    Technical Specifications

    • Model Architecture: SDXL Turbo uses a novel distillation technique called Adversarial Diffusion Distillation (ADD).
    • Key Features: Single-step image generation, high-quality sampling in 1 to 4 steps.
    • Training Base: Fine-tuned from SDXL 1.0.
    • Resource Availability: Model weights and code are available on Hugging Face and Stability AI’s generative-models GitHub repository.
